shift15848374635 2025-03-19 18:10 采纳率: 86.7%
浏览 83
已结题

进行立创庐山派k230开发板驱动时出问题

在进行开发板驱动后弹出以下弹窗应该怎么办?是不是要把文件换位置

img

img

  • 写回答

4条回答 默认 最新

  • 码农阿豪@新空间 新星创作者: 前端开发技术领域 2025-03-19 18:37
    关注
    让阿豪来帮你解答,本回答参考chatgpt3.5编写提供,如果还有疑问可以评论或留言
    在进行开发板驱动完成后,如果弹出了您提到的错误弹窗,通常表明系统无法找到或者识别某个必要的文件或驱动程序。这种情况可能导致开发板无法正常工作。根据您的描述,文件位置的正确性可能是造成问题的一个原因。以下是解决此问题的步骤和建议:

    解决步骤:

    1. 检查驱动文件位置
      • 确认驱动程序文件是否在正确的位置。通常,驱动文件应该存放在系统指定的目录(如 /lib/modules/$(uname -r)/ 目录下)。
      • 如果出现错误信息指向了特定的文件位置,可以尝试将该文件移动到正确的目录。
    2. 更新驱动程序
      • 如果驱动已经存在,但系统仍然无法识别,尝试更新或重新安装驱动程序。
      sudo apt-get update
      sudo apt-get install --reinstall <驱动程序包名>
      
    3. 查看系统日志

      • 使用 dmesgjournalctl 命令查看系统日志,寻找与驱动程序相关的错误信息,以更好地理解问题所在。
      dmesg | grep -i <驱动名称>
      
    4. 执行重启
      • 在更改驱动程序或文件位置后,重启系统以确保变动生效。
    5. 检查模块加载

      • 确保驱动支持模块的正确加载,可以使用 lsmod 查看当前加载的模块。
      • 使用 modprobe <模块名> 手动加载驱动。
      sudo modprobe <模块名>
      

    案例分析:

    假设您在使用 Raspberry Pi 开发板,并且在弹出窗口中看到如下错误信息:“未找到 usb_driver.ko 文件”。针对这个情况,您可以采取以下步骤: 1. 使用 SSH 或控制台访问 Raspberry Pi。 2. 检查 /lib/modules/$(uname -r)/ 目录下是否有 usb_driver.ko 文件。如果没有,可以从备份或者官网下载对应版本的驱动程序,移动到此目录。 3. 重新运行 modprobe usb_driver。 4. 如果仍有问题,请查看 dmesg 输出,确保模块正确加载。

    代码示例:

    以下是一个示例代码来帮助您检查驱动程序文件位置:

    # 检查驱动文件是否存在
    if [ -f "/lib/modules/$(uname -r)/kernel/drivers/usb/usb_driver.ko" ]; then
        echo "驱动文件存在"
    else
        echo "驱动文件不存在,您需要移动或安装驱动程序"
        # 这里可以放置下载和安装驱动程序的代码
    fi
    

    结论:

    如果您遇到驱动相关的错误弹窗,不仅需要检查文件位置,还需要确认驱动程序的安装和加载状态。希望上述步骤能够帮助您解决问题。如果有进一步的问题,请提供更多细节。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(3条)

报告相同问题?

问题事件

  • 系统已结题 4月4日
  • 已采纳回答 3月27日
  • 创建了问题 3月19日